In pharmaceutical production facilities, keeping a sterile atmosphere is paramount. Also the smallest particles of dirt or microbes can pollute drugs, rendering them inefficient or perhaps damaging to people. This is where air purification systems come into play, utilizing innovative filtration modern technologies to remove pollutants and keep air quality within cleanrooms.

Among the vital components of air purification systems is high-efficiency particle air (HEPA) filters. These filters can capturing bits as tiny as 0.3 microns with a high level of efficiency, making sure that the air flowing within cleanrooms is free from dust, germs, and various other air-borne impurities. Additionally, some systems integrate ultraviolet (UV) light or ionization innovation to more sterilize the air, offering an additional layer of security versus virus.

Air bathroom are another important function of pharmaceutical production facilities. These enclosed chambers are geared up with high-velocity air jets that blow away impurities from personnel entering or exiting cleanroom areas. By subjecting employees to a brief but intense burst of clean air, air shower rooms help avoid the introduction of pollutants into sterilized atmospheres, minimizing the danger of item contamination.

In the realm of medication manufacturing, analytical instruments play an essential role in quality control and assurance. High-tech instruments such as chromatographs and spectrometers enable pharma companies to analyze the make-up of resources and ended up items with accuracy, making certain that every tablet and potion meets strict security and efficacy standards.

Chromatography, a technique made use of to divide and examine complicated mixes, is widely employed in pharmaceutical evaluation. High-performance fluid chromatography (HPLC) and gas chromatography (GC) are two common variants of this strategy, each offering special advantages for the analysis of pharmaceutical substances. By dividing private components within an example, chromatography enables researchers to quantify the focus of energetic ingredients and detect contaminations with high level of sensitivity.

Spectroscopy is another effective logical tool used in pharmaceutical evaluation. Methods such as ultraviolet-visible (UV-Vis) spectroscopy, infrared (IR) spectroscopy, and nuclear magnetic vibration (NMR) spectroscopy provide valuable insights right into the chemical structure and properties of pharmaceutical substances. By determining the absorption or emission of light at details wavelengths, spectroscopic techniques can identify materials, examine purity, and display chemical reactions in real-time.

Water is a crucial component in pharmaceutical production, used for cleansing, formula, and as a solvent in numerous manufacturing processes. The top quality of water should fulfill strict governing demands to make certain the security and efficiency of pharmaceutical products. Filtration systems such as reverse osmosis and distillation get rid of impurities such as minerals, germs, and organic compounds, generating water more info that meets pharmaceutical-grade criteria.
